I will offer a counterpoint to the virtues of this product. I tried this exact version a few years ago direct from the company and sent it back. The cooling function really isn't cooling as much as it is pumping ambient air from the floor into the sheets. That may or may not be cooler air depending on the region you live in and how humid your air is. I've actually setup a fan next to my bed on hot nights with a small gap exposed at the bottom of the sheet and felt like it was the same experience albeit not as much air flow. I'm not going to dispute whether Bed Jet helps people or not as it either does or does not create a better night sleep but I just could not get on-board for the price point and lack of real cooling. I also felt like the marketing was a bit disengenious. Lastly, I have also grown fond of the feel of a heavy weighted blanket which this product tends to create the opposite. I'm not sure it would be very easy to DIY a replacement (at least the remote control) but I believe they mentioned on the company's Shark Tank debut that it cost a whopping $98 to make the product. Just sharing my two cents and experience with the product.

We have had ours for a few years. Spouse hit M and was having real issues at night. Bought this for them as a gift and set it up on her side of the bed. We have a king and do not use the air sheet.
On 25-30% fan speed it gives just enough air to cool off the area at her feet. I can slide my feet over or away as needed. Laying on my side closer to her I can get a bit of a draft but otherwise I don't notice it on my side.
The app sucks. We have the remote. The version we bought had some failure issues on the remote but Bedjet has always been great with sending a replacement remote free of charge. The remote, backlit is must as it is not nearly as brite as the app.
As others have stated, it is more of a fan with a heating element but it is replacing body temp air with room temp air and makes quite a difference under the sheets. We rarely use warm mode but it works.
At 30% you barely hear it. At 100% it certainly sounds like a quiet fan and inflates the bedsheets/blankets.
If you are approaching or in M, this thing is really amazing.
